From 8c6fbc506e9a2c8cde56a794d8319cc55f4be666 Mon Sep 17 00:00:00 2001 From: wujingjing <gersonwu@qq.com> Date: 星期二, 11 二月 2025 15:56:48 +0800 Subject: [PATCH] 修复问题 --- src/components/chat/smallChat/WorkOrderDlg.vue | 26 +++++++++++++------------- 1 files changed, 13 insertions(+), 13 deletions(-) diff --git a/src/components/chat/smallChat/WorkOrderDlg.vue b/src/components/chat/smallChat/WorkOrderDlg.vue index 050a762..f7c5bf1 100644 --- a/src/components/chat/smallChat/WorkOrderDlg.vue +++ b/src/components/chat/smallChat/WorkOrderDlg.vue @@ -12,18 +12,18 @@ <el-form-item label="宸ュ崟缂栧彿" prop="id" disabled> <el-input v-model="dialogFormValue.id" readonly></el-input> </el-form-item> - <el-form-item label="宸ュ崟鍚嶇О" prop="name"> - <el-input v-model="dialogFormValue.name"></el-input> + <el-form-item label="宸ュ崟鍚嶇О" prop="title"> + <el-input v-model="dialogFormValue.title"></el-input> </el-form-item> <el-form-item label="宸ュ崟绫诲瀷" prop="type"> <el-select v-model="dialogFormValue.type"> <el-option v-for="item in [ - { ID: '1', Name: '璁惧缁存姢' }, - { ID: '2', Name: '娴侀噺寮傚父' }, - { ID: '3', Name: '鍘嬪姏寮傚父' }, - { ID: '4', Name: '姘磋川寮傚父' }, - { ID: '5', Name: '鐢ㄦ埛鎶曡瘔' }, + { ID: '璁惧缁翠慨', Name: '璁惧缁翠慨' }, + { ID: '娴侀噺寮傚父', Name: '娴侀噺寮傚父' }, + { ID: '鍘嬪姏寮傚父', Name: '鍘嬪姏寮傚父' }, + { ID: '姘磋川寮傚父', Name: '姘磋川寮傚父' }, + { ID: '鐢ㄦ埛鎶曡瘔', Name: '鐢ㄦ埛鎶曡瘔' }, ]" :key="item.ID" @@ -49,8 +49,8 @@ </el-select> </el-form-item> --> - <el-form-item label="澶囨敞" prop="note"> - <el-input v-model="dialogFormValue.note" type="textarea" :rows="3"></el-input> + <el-form-item label="澶囨敞" prop="remark"> + <el-input v-model="dialogFormValue.remark" type="textarea" :rows="3"></el-input> </el-form-item> <el-form-item label="闄勪欢鍥剧墖" prop="pic"> <el-upload @@ -110,7 +110,7 @@ //#region ====================== 澧炲姞銆佷慨鏀硅褰曟搷浣�, dialog init====================== const isEditDialog = ref(false); const dialogTitle = computed(() => { - return isEditDialog.value ? '淇敼椤甸潰' : '鍒涘缓宸ュ崟'; + return isEditDialog.value ? '鍒涘缓宸ュ崟' : '鍒涘缓宸ュ崟'; }); const dialogHeaderIcon = computed(() => { return isEditDialog.value ? 'ele-Edit' : 'ele-Plus'; @@ -128,11 +128,11 @@ const openOperateDialog = (row?) => { if (row) { isEditDialog.value = true; - const { id, note, prompt, question, title } = row; - dialogFormValue.value = deepClone({ id, note, prompt, question, title }); + const { title,type,content,remark,} = row; + dialogFormValue.value = deepClone({id: `GM_${formatDate(new Date(),'YYYY_mmdd_HHMMSS')}`,title,type,content,remark}); } else { isEditDialog.value = false; - dialogFormValue.value = {id: `GM_${formatDate(new Date())}`, name: '', type: '', content: '', note: ''}; + dialogFormValue.value = {id: `GM_${formatDate(new Date(),'YYYY_mmdd_HHMMSS')}`, name: '', type: '', content: '', note: ''}; } }; const closeDialog = () => { -- Gitblit v1.9.3